[ 永远的UNIX::UNIX技术资料的宝库 ]

首页 > 系统管理 > 其它 > 正文

中文man手册:sort - 对文本文件的行排序

来源:本文出自:http://www.cmpp.net 作者: (2001-09-23 08:05:00)

SORT

Section: FSF (1)
Updated: 1999年12月

 

NAME(名称)

sort - 对文本文件的行排序  

SYNOPSIS(总览)

../src/sort [OPTION]... [FILE]...  

DESCRIPTION(描述)

? 谡舛砑尤魏胃郊拥拿枋鲂畔?

将排序好的所有文件串写到标准输出上.

+POS1 [-POS2]
从关键字POS1开始,到POS2*之前*结束(快过时了) 字段数和字符偏移量都从零开始计数(与-k选项比较)
-b
忽略排序字段或关键字中开头的空格
-c
检查是否指定文件已经排序好了,不排序.
-d
在关键字中只考虑[a-zA-Z0-9]字符.
-f
将关键字中的小写字母折合成大写字母.
-g
按照通常的数字值顺序作比较,暗含-b
-i
在关键字中只考虑[\040-\0176]字符.
-k POS1[,POS2]
从关键字POS1开始,*到*POS2结束. 字段数和字符偏移量都从1开始计数(与基于零的+POS格式作比较)
-l
按照当前环境排序.
-m
合并已经排序好的文件,不排序.
-M
按(未知的)<`JAN'<...<`DEC'的顺序比较,暗含-b
-n
按照字符串的数值顺序比较,暗含-b
-o FILE
将结果写入FILE而不是标准输出.
-r
颠倒比较的结果.
-s
通过屏蔽最后的再分类比较来稳定排序.
-t SEP
使用SEP来替代空格的转换non-.
-T DIRECTORY
使用DIRECTORY作为临时文件,而不是$TMPDIR或者/tmp
-u
如果有-c,则按严格的顺序进行检查; 如果有-m,则只输出相等顺序的第一个.
-z
以0字节结束行,而不是使用换行符,这是为了找到-print0
--help
显示帮助并退出.
--version
输出版本信息并退出.

POS为F[.C][OPTS],这里的F指的是字段数,而C为字段中的字符位置,这在-k中是从开 始计数的,而在过时的格式中是从零开始的.OPTS可由一个或多个Mbdfinr组成;这有效地屏蔽了 对于那个关键字的全局-Mbdfinr设置.如果没有指定关键字,则使用整行作为关键字.如 果没有FILE,或者FILE是-,则从标准输入读取.  

AUTHOR(作者)

Mike Haertel  

REPORTING BUGS(报告BUGS)

报告bugs,请发到<bug-textutils@gnu.org>.  

COPYRIGHT(版权)

版权所有?1999 Free Software Foundation, Inc.
这是自由软件;参见关于复制条件的源文件.不承担任何责任;更不用说商用性或特殊需求的适 应性.  

SEE ALSO (另见)

sort 的完整文档是以Texinfo手册的方式维护的.如果在你那儿正确地安装了 infosort 程序,命令
info sort

应该可以让你访问整个手册.

 

[中文版维护人]

riser E-mail:boomer@ccidnet.com  

[中文版最新更新]

2000/12/5
(http://www.fanqiang.com)



 
 相关文章

★  感谢所有的作者为我们学习技术知识提供了一条捷径  ★
www.fanqiang.com